    Arreola tried his best, but his skillset is sorely lacking. He applied pressure, but I don't think it was effective pressure at all. No head movement...just a case of plodding forward and taking punches on the guard. He would occasionally get close and Vitali would just tie him up. There were countless times when he could have pinned Vitali and unloaded a combination but Vitali was just allowed to circle freely. Arreola has heart, but he just isn't all that good a fighter. But fair play on him seeing it through as far as possible.

    For me that was a quality showing from Klitschko and the best I've seen from him in a long while. He has great stamina for a big old guy and just keeps on flicking out the 1-2's and 3/4 punch combinations. No doubt that Vitali is the better of the Klit brothers. He really stomps on his opponents in a way that Wlad just seems too timid to do.

    I would like to see James Toney have a go with Arreola in the very near future.
